Summary

Red Hat JBoss Enterprise Application Platform is a platform for Java applications based on the JBoss Application Server.
This release of Red Hat JBoss Enterprise Application Platform 7.1.6 serves as a replacement for Red Hat JBoss Enterprise Application Platform 7.1.5, and includes bug fixes and enhancements, which are documented in the Release Notes document linked to in the References.
Security Fix(es):
* wildfly-core: Cross-site scripting (XSS) in JBoss Management Console (CVE-2018-10934)
* undertow: Infoleak in some circumstances where Undertow can serve data from a random buffer (CVE-2018-14642)
* dom4j: XML Injection in Class: Element. Methods: addElement, addAttribute which can impact the integrity of XML documents (CVE-2018-1000632)
For more details about the security issue(s), including the impact, a CVSS score, and other related information, refer to the CVE page(s) listed in the References section.

Bugs Fixed

1615673 - CVE-2018-10934 wildfly-core: Cross-site scripting (XSS) in JBoss Management Console

1620529 - CVE-2018-1000632 dom4j: XML Injection in Class: Element. Methods: addElement, addAttribute which can impact the integrity of XML documents

1628702 - CVE-2018-14642 undertow: Infoleak in some circumstances where Undertow can serve data from a random buffer
